Bug description:
Binary package hint: hdparm
Ubuntu 7.10, hdparm 7.5-1ubuntu1. My /etc/hdparm.conf has entries
like
/dev/disk/by-id/ata-ST3160023A_4JS03MMK {
spindown_time = 60
}
which work just fine with /etc/init.d/hdparm. However, it appears
init.d/hdparm is on its way out and has been replaced with
/lib/udev/hdparm. That only executes hdparm(8) for bits of
/etc/hdparm.conf that match $DEVNAME, presumably passed in by udev. I
guess it'll have values like /dev/sda or /dev/hda. However, I don't
necessarily know what the /dev name will be, so I've specified it by
/dev/disk/by-id instead which is a symlink.
$ stat -c %N /dev/disk/by-id/ata-ST3160023A_4JS03MMK
`/dev/disk/by-id/ata-ST3160023A_4JS03MMK' -> `../../hda'
It seems that /lib/udev/hdparm needs to do some readlink(1) or similar
for each of the discs specified in /etc/hdparm.conf, e.g. `readlink -e
/dev/disk/by-id/ata-ST3160023A_4JS03MMK' gives /dev/hda, and only then
compare against $DEVNAME.
